Actually, I don't really know what people use for home arcade setups. What I know about arcade boards is like: you need a game PCB, a motherboard to play that PCB, a supergun to work as a device that connects the motherboard to a TV and controller and power source. Is that correct?

I feel like I didn't really understand chaining in this game until I played in tournament and had to think about the game differently. The single player only rewards you for playing safely and cleaning up your mess, especially with how Perfects give a nice full screen image, so I never really put much thought into layering or building for a certain purpose. Also most games are just self contained pcbs. I think that's still true even as the industry turned toward mvs-style system boards in the 90s. an st-v, mvs, cps, f-3, atomiswave, that's all way less common than just a bare pcb you slap into a jamma harness, in the grand scheme. Even snk released some bare pcb versions of later games - I've got kof xi that way.
